2007年陕西、湖北和四川三省小麦叶锈菌苗期毒性分析

摘要:

采用40个鉴别寄主在苗期对2007年采自我国四川、湖北和陕西三省小麦叶锈菌菌株进行致病性鉴定及毒性基因频率分析。结果表明:2007年四川省主要致病类型为THTT,出现频率为11.1%;湖北省主要致病类型为THQT、THQS、THQR、THQN和PHSP,出现总频率为61.8%;陕西省主要致病类型为PHST和FHST,出现总频率为17.1%。三省小麦叶锈菌的群体结构组成复杂。毒性基因V9、V19、V24、V38、V39、V40、V41、V42、V43和V45在三省中的毒性基因频率均小于21%,其中V9、V24和V38的毒力频率为0,说明其对应的小麦抗叶锈病基因在小麦抗叶锈病育种中具有较高的利用价值;毒性基因V2c、V3、V3bg、VB、V11、V14a、V14b、V16、V25、V26和V33在三省中的毒性基因频率均大于70%,其对应的抗叶锈基因为无效抗叶锈基因。毒性基因V1、V2a、V15、V19、V28和V30的毒性基因频率在三省中存在较大差异。

Abstract:

Collections of Puccinia triticina were obtained from rust-infected wheat leaves throughout ShanXi、HuBei and SiChuan provinces of China in 2007. Single uredinial isolates were derived from the collections and tested for virulence phenotype on 40 differential hosts. The most common phenotype was THTT in Sichuan province and its frequency was 11.1%; were the main pathotypes in Hubei province and the frequency of the five pathotypes THQT,THQS,THQR,THQN and PHSP were 61.8%; PHST and FHST were the main virulence phenotypes in Shanxi province and the frequency of the two pathotypes were 17.1%. The result of virulence frequency analysis indicated that the virulence frequency of V9, V19, V24, V38, V39, V40, V41, V42, V43 and V45 were lower than 21% in the three provinces, and the virulence frequency of V9, V24, V38 were 0, which suggested the corresponding resistance genes are effective resistance genes in wheat breeding. But the virulence frequency of V2c, V3, V3bg, V11, VB, V14a, V14b, V16, V25, V26 and V33 were above 70%, which suggested the corresponding resistance genes lost their resistance to the pathogen in the three provinces. The virulence frequency of V1、V2a、V15、V19、V28 and V30 showed obvious difference in three provinces.
